Originally Posted by klyeo' post='439155' date='Jun 23 2007, 04:33 PM
reset the meter after each fill up in the i Drive for a more accurate usage for the mpg.
you can also do it manually by calculating. after a fill-up, drive until another needed fill-up and record how many miles driven. then divide that by how many gallons of gas you fill up with at the next fill-up. do it a couple times to get an average during that time too. just another option.

I have been averaging 21.4 mpg, mostly city driving, and that is using a manual calculation which is about 5% lower than the car's computer. My best was 23.9 mpg and worst was 19.4 mpg.
